Hannah Hijleh

Hannah Hijleh is an actively performing classical violinist, relocating to the Bay Area from New York City. With a Bachelor's Degree in Violin Performance from the Greatbatch School of Music, she seeks to have an active dual teaching/performing professional life with an emphasis on chamber music. She has spent the last several years as the concert master of the Houghton Symphony and as the first violin in the Bravada String Quartet.

 

Hannah has worked with a number of reputable teachers and performers including Martha Thomas, Charlie Castleman of Eastman and Frost School of Music, Laura Bossert of Syracuse University, Sally Thomas of the Juilliard School, Ann Setzer of Mannes at the New School, and Stephanie Chase of NYU. She has also attended Summer Strings at NYU, Meadowmount School of Music, and the Castleman Quartet Program, during the summers, where she was coached by notable individuals such as Kikuei Ikeda from the Tokyo String Quartet and John Kochanowski (a protegé of Robert Mann, a member of the Juilliard String Quartet).
